Ezra 6 — Overview

Treasury of Scripture Knowledge · Canne, Browne, Blayney, Scott, and others · Public Domain

, Darius, finding the decree of Cyrus, makes a new decree for the advancement of the building; , By the help of Tatnai and Shethar-boznai, according to the decree, the temple is finished; , The feast of the dedication is kept; , and the passover.
